dillydally的基础释义为:

指因拖延时间而浪费时间,徘徊不前。

指做事时故意拖延时间。

dillydally的发音为:

/?d?l??de?li/。

以下是一些与dillydally相关的英语范文:

例句:I kept dilly-dallying and didn't start my homework until late in the afternoon.

译文:我一直在拖延,直到下午晚些时候才开始做作业。

Dillydally

Dillydally is a common term used to describe the act of procrastinating or delaying a task. It is often used to describe someone who is unproductive or unfocused, as they spend time doing unimportant tasks instead of completing their main objectives.

One day, I had a task to complete an assignment for my class. However, instead of starting on the assignment immediately, I found myself idly staring at my computer screen, scrolling through social media or checking my emails. This behavior became a habitual pattern, and I found myself constantly delaying the task.

However, eventually I realized that this behavior was not only wasteful but also harmful to my academic progress. I made a conscious effort to stop dillydallying and start working on the assignment immediately. By doing so, I was able to complete it on time and avoid any further procrastination.

In conclusion, dillydallying can be a harmful habit that can lead to missed deadlines and poor academic performance. It is important to recognize the negative effects of dillydallying and take action to stop it as soon as possible. By prioritizing tasks and setting realistic deadlines, we can avoid this habit and achieve our goals more effectively.

Dillydally

Dillydally is a habit of procrastinating or delaying a task. It is often caused by not having a clear plan or goal, or by being too focused on the small details of the task.

The problem with dillydallying is that it can lead to missed deadlines and missed opportunities. If you delay a task, you may end up having to work harder or longer to complete it, which can be frustrating and time-consuming.

To avoid dillydallying, it is important to have a clear plan and goal for the task at hand. Break the task down into smaller, more manageable steps and focus on completing each step before moving on to the next one. Also, be disciplined and set realistic deadlines for yourself.
